Output d848c09c9982cf6721da1d65690dbbe5a21e7128c505809bc9231f1c010442e5:3

value
429430
script pubkey
OP_0 OP_PUSHBYTES_20 bb4a5d6f5e7aa904d679b571c4be538cb473649a
address
tb1qhd996m67025sf4nek4cuf0jn3j68xey6j7cauu
transaction
d848c09c9982cf6721da1d65690dbbe5a21e7128c505809bc9231f1c010442e5
confirmations
33984
spent
true